April 10, 2024 a national holiday for Eid’l Fitr – Palace

by Carl Santos

PRESIDENT Ferdinand Marcos Jr. has declared April 10, Wednesday, a regular holiday across the country to mark Eid’l Fitr, the end of the Muslim holy month of Ramadan. 

Marcos signed Proclamation 514, which aims to bring the religious and cultural significance of Eid’l Fitr ”to the fore of national consciousness,” on April 4. 

The President said the proclamation would also allow Filipinos to join their Muslim brothers and sisters in the observance of Eid’l Fitr. 

Muslims began observing Ramadan, or the month of fasting, on March 12.
